1. Dark Matter

Scientists estimate that approximately 85% of the universe’s matter is invisible.

Known as dark matter, it cannot be directly observed because it does not emit, absorb, or reflect light. Researchers know it exists because of its gravitational effects on galaxies.

Despite decades of study, nobody knows exactly what dark matter is made of.


2. Dark Energy

If dark matter is mysterious, dark energy is even stranger.

Scientists believe dark energy is responsible for the accelerating expansion of the universe.

Shockingly, dark energy may account for nearly 70% of the cosmos, yet its true nature remains unknown.

5. Fast Radio Bursts

Fast Radio Bursts (FRBs) are powerful bursts of radio energy originating from deep space.

These bursts last only milliseconds but release enormous amounts of energy.

Scientists have identified possible sources, yet their true origin remains uncertain.


6. Ball Lightning

For centuries, people have reported seeing glowing spheres floating through the air during storms.

Known as ball lightning, these strange phenomena have been witnessed worldwide.

Although researchers have recreated similar effects in laboratories, no complete explanation exists.

10. The Fermi Paradox

The universe contains billions of stars and potentially trillions of planets.

If intelligent life is common, where is everybody?

The contradiction between the probability of extraterrestrial civilizations and the lack of evidence is known as the Fermi Paradox.


11. The Great Attractor

Astronomers have discovered that our galaxy and thousands of others are moving toward an enormous gravitational anomaly called the Great Attractor.

Its exact nature remains largely unknown because much of it lies behind dense regions of the Milky Way.


12. The Wow! Signal

In 1977, astronomers detected a powerful radio signal from space.

The signal was so unusual that researcher Jerry Ehman famously wrote “Wow!” next to the data.

The source has never been conclusively identified.


13. The Voynich Manuscript

This mysterious medieval book contains strange illustrations and an unknown writing system.

Despite years of analysis by linguists, historians, and cryptographers, nobody has successfully decoded it.

17. The Antikythera Mechanism

Discovered in a shipwreck, the Antikythera Mechanism is often called the world’s first analog computer.

Its complexity was centuries ahead of its time.

Scientists still wonder how ancient engineers developed such advanced technology.


18. Quantum Entanglement

Albert Einstein referred to it as “spooky action at a distance.”

Quantum entanglement allows particles to remain connected regardless of distance.

Scientists can describe the phenomenon mathematically, but its deeper implications remain mysterious.

21. Rogue Waves

For years, sailors reported enormous waves appearing unexpectedly in the ocean.

Scientists once considered these stories exaggerated.

Today, rogue waves are known to exist, but predicting them remains difficult.

25. What Happens Inside Black Holes?

Black holes are among the most extreme objects in existence.

Scientists understand how they form and behave externally.

However, what occurs beyond the event horizon remains one of the biggest mysteries in modern physics.
